  • Youth Futures Foundation comments: ONS labour market stats

    Stuart Gentle Publisher at Onrec16 Apr 2025|OpinionYouth Futures Foundation comments: ONS labour market statsAbigail Coxon, Senior Economist, Youth Futures Foundation, comments:"Today's labour market data from the ONS shows that youth unemployment continues to rise. Over the past year, the unemployment rate for people aged 16-24 not in full-time education has increased from 11.4% to 13.3%. This reflects an additional 77,000 young people who are unemployed.
